ZIP-bestanden als bronnen voor presentaties
Als u ZIP-bestanden wilt gebruiken als bron voor Intelligent Content-presentaties, maakt u een afzonderlijk ZIP-bestand voor elke pagina in de presentatie. Neem in elk afzonderlijk zipbestand de HTML-inhoud voor de presentatiepagina op. In Life Sciences Customer Engagement worden pagina's gegroepeerd in presentaties en wordt elke pagina afzonderlijk weergegeven in de presentatiespeler. Beheerders kunnen ook elke presentatiepagina koppelen aan een product en een kernboodschap. Salesforce houdt presentatiemeetgegevens bij voor elke pagina, zodat u de prestaties in de loop van de tijd kunt analyseren en verbeteren.
Vereiste editions
| Beschikbaar in: Lightning Experience |
| Beschikbaar in: Enterprise en Unlimited Edition met Life Sciences Cloud, Life Sciences Cloud voor Customer Engagement Add-on-licentie en het beheerde pakket Life Sciences Customer Engagement. |
Life Sciences Customer Engagement downloadt presentaties en pagina's, terwijl de presentatiespeler de HTML-, CSS- en JavaScript-code uitvoert om elke pagina te tonen.
Inhoud van presentatiepagina
Neem in het ZIP-bestand voor elke presentatiepagina deze items op.
| Inhoud | Verplicht | Beschrijving |
|---|---|---|
| HTML-bestanden | Verplicht | HTML-bestanden bevatten de code voor elke dia. Gebruik voor elke HTML-bestandsnaam de indeling XX_naam.html, waarbij XX het dianummer is. Begin op pagina 01 en verhoog sequentieel voor elke extra pagina. Raadpleeg in de HTML-bestanden CSS- en JavaScript-bestanden voor stijlen en acties. |
| Een JPEG-bestand | Verplicht | JPEG's vertegenwoordigen de miniatuurafbeelding van elke pagina. Gebruik voor elke JPEG-bestandsnaam de indeling XX_thumbnail.jpg, waarbij XX het paginanummer is. Beperk de miniatuurgrootte tot minder dan 3050 kB of 2,97 MB. De optimale resolutie voor elke afbeelding is 328 bij 232 pixels. Voor andere resoluties gebruikt de afbeelding de methode Aspectvulling. |
| CSS- en JavaScript-bestanden | Optioneel | Statische resources waarnaar de HTML-bestanden verwijzen. |
Aanbevelingen voor bestandsnamen voor zip-bronbestanden
Volg deze richtlijnen voor PDF-bestandsnamen. Wanneer beheerders presentatie-ZIP-bestanden uploaden naar Life Sciences Customer Engagement, worden presentatiepagina's alfabetisch gesorteerd.
- Gebruik de indeling XX_name.zip voor de postcode van elke pagina, waarbij XX het paginanummer is en de naam een beschrijvende titel. Het paginanummer mag niet langer zijn dan 2 lettertekens. De beschrijvende titel moet minstens 2 lettertekens bevatten.
- Beperk de bestandsnaamgrootte tot 960 bytes of minder.
- Geldige lettertekens zijn A-Z, A-Z en 0-9.
- HTML-bestandsnamen mogen geen spaties bevatten.
- Voor presentaties die beheerders uploaden in Life Sciences Customer Engagement:
- Deze speciale lettertekens worden ondersteund: -, ., _, !, *, ’, (, )
- Deze speciale lettertekens worden niet ondersteund: /, \ en de combinaties `“ en `”.
- U wordt aangeraden om geen andere speciale tekens te gebruiken.
- Voor presentaties die zijn geüpload via de Connect-API voor Content Management, worden speciale lettertekens niet ondersteund.
- Bestandsextensies zijn hoofdlettergevoelig en moeten in kleine letters zijn, bijvoorbeeld .jpg.
- Double-byte Kana, Katakana en getallen worden ondersteund, maar verschillende besturingssystemen kunnen mutaties veroorzaken.
Inhoudsaanbevelingen voor zip-bronbestanden
Volg deze richtlijnen voor presentatie-inhoud in ZIP-bronbestanden.
- Elk ZIP-bestand moet minstens één HTML-bestand en het bijbehorende JPEG-miniatuurbestand bevatten. Bijvoorbeeld 02_secondSlide.html en 02_thumbnail.jpg.
- Elk HTML-bestand moet een overeenkomende miniatuurafbeelding bevatten.
- Miniatuurafbeeldingen moeten JPEG-indeling hebben. PNG- en GIF-bestanden worden niet ondersteund.
- Als één ZIP-bestand voor een presentatiepagina meer dan 100 dia's bevat, wordt aangeraden om afzonderlijke pagina-ZIP-bestanden te maken voor elke set van 100 dia's.
- Elk zipbestand van een presentatiepagina moet 1 GB of kleiner zijn.
- CSS- en JavaScript-bestanden zijn niet vereist in ZIP-bestanden van presentatiepagina's.
- In elk zipbestand van een presentatiepagina kunt u meerdere HTML-, JPEG-, CSS- en JavaScript-bestanden opnemen.
- HTML- en JPEG-bestanden moeten zich op het hoogste niveau bevinden in elk ZIP-bestand van een presentatiepagina. Als u meerdere CSS- en JavaScript-bestanden opneemt, kunt u hiervoor mappen maken.
- Als u een presentatie maakt als één HTML-bestand en
<div>gebruikt om elke pagina weer te geven, wordt de inhoud weergegeven als één presentatiepagina in de presentatiespeler.
PDF-bestanden toevoegen aan presentaties
U kunt videobestanden opnemen in ZIP-bestanden van presentatiepagina's en naar de video's verwijzen in de HTML-code van een presentatiepagina. Dit voorbeeld van HTML-code voor de presentatiepagina bevat een verwijzing naar een PDF-bestand.
<a href="dam/iselling/pdf/example.pdf">EXAMPLE PDF FILE</a>Video's toevoegen aan presentaties
U kunt videobestanden opnemen in ZIP-bestanden van presentatiepagina's en naar de video's verwijzen in de HTML-code van een presentatiepagina. De video wordt weergegeven op die pagina in de presentatie. De presentatiespeler ondersteunt deze video-indelingen. Neem in de HTML-code het kenmerk type op.
| Video-indeling | Kenmerk HTML-type |
|---|---|
| MP4 | "video/mp4" |
| MOV | "video/quicktime" |
| M4V | "video/x-m4v" |
Dit voorbeeld van HTML-code voor de presentatiepagina bevat een verwijzing naar een MP4-videobestand.
<video width="320" height="240" controls> <source src="./assets/movie.mp4" type="video/mp4"> Your browser does not support the video tag. </video>Video's gebruiken voor externe betrokkenheid
Video's worden ondersteund voor externe sessies wanneer uw Salesforce-organisatie Twilio als serviceprovider gebruikt. Ingebedde video's en animaties werken mogelijk anders in de presentatiespeler tijdens externe sessies. Als u animaties wilt opnemen, wordt aangeraden om in plaats daarvan HTML- of JavaScript-code te gebruiken.
Koppelen naar externe inhoud in presentaties
U kunt een koppeling naar externe webpagina's maken vanuit de HTML-code van de presentatiepagina. Koppelingen naar PDF-bestanden of externe inhoud worden altijd in een afzonderlijk venster geopend. Gebruik voor het koppelen naar een externe webpagina deze indeling.
<a href="https://www.google.com/">Google.com</a>Zie de norm RFC 3986 voor details over de lettertekens die u kunt opnemen in URL's.
Extra inhoud toevoegen aan presentaties
In presentatie-ZIP-bestanden kunt u extra inhoud toevoegen als PDF-bestanden en koppelingen gebruiken om naar die bestanden te verwijzen vanaf elke pagina in de presentatie. Als u een PDF-bestand als extra context wilt markeren, voegt u isadditionalcontent_ toe als prefix in de bestandsnaam. Gebruik voor het koppelen naar een extra PDF-bestand met inhoud de functie gotoSlide().
Wanneer beheerders aanvullende inhoud uploaden als onderdeel van een presentatie van een ZIP-bestand in Life Sciences Customer Engagement, wordt het selectievakje Aanvullende inhoud automatisch geselecteerd in de record van de presentatiepagina. Beheerders kunnen ook PDF-bestanden met extra inhoud uploaden als presentatiebronbestanden wanneer ze presentaties in bulk uploaden of bijwerken.
iFrame gebruiken in presentaties
U kunt iFrames gebruiken in de HTML-code van de presentatiepagina. Scrollen wordt ondersteund binnen het iFrame. Deze kenmerken worden ondersteund.
allowheightnamesandboxsrcsrcdocwidth
Prestaties van zipbestanden optimaliseren op iPad
Als u ervoor wilt zorgen dat presentaties snel worden geladen en goed presteren op iPads, volgt u deze richtlijnen wanneer u ZIP-bestanden voor presentatiepagina's samenstelt.
- Comprimeer afbeeldingen voordat u ze toevoegt aan presentaties.
- Vermijd het toevoegen van uitgebreide JavaScript-logica aan elke pagina, zoals navigatiebalken, tabbladen, knopinfo en vervolgkeuzemenu's.
- Gebruik geen Content Management System (CMS) om pagina's te genereren, aangezien het CMS onnodige code kan toevoegen en de laadtijden van pagina's kan vertragen.
- Verdeel complexe pagina's over meerdere eenvoudige pagina's. Als u bijvoorbeeld één pagina met horizontale of verticale tabbladen hebt, maakt u in plaats daarvan een afzonderlijke pagina voor elk tabblad.
- Voeg een achtergrond, een eenvoudige afbeelding of een kleur toe aan de hoofdteksttag die aangeeft wanneer de pagina wordt geladen.
- Zorg ervoor dat gebruikers ondersteunde mobiele apparaten gebruiken.
Voorbeeld HTML-pagina in ZIP-bestandspresentaties
Deze voorbeeld-HTML-pagina vermeldt alle klanten en drukt hun namen af.
<!DOCTYPE html>
<html>
<head>
<link type="text/css" rel ="stylesheet" href="media/css/style.css">
</head>
<body>
<div id="screen-container">
HELLO
{{#customers}} <!--this is a mustache loop -->
<span id="doc_name" class="template">{{firstName }} {{ lastName }}</span>
{{/customers}}
,<br/>DO YOU WANT TO START THE VISIT?</span>
</div>
</body>
</html>
